Re: Plans to Restock Items?

These products may be out of stock for a couple of reasons.

First and foremost, they know their main customer, robotics teams, are much less active during the summer than they are during the school year, so it makes sense that they wouldn't plan on carrying much stock over the summer (typically companies want to carry stock for as short a time as possible, as stock sitting on a shelf represents money invested that isn't generating cash flow).

You should also keep in mind that these companies have been known to release product updates in the fall (example), and they may want to let products that are being updated empty off the shelves before they become obsolete, and to free up room for the new products.

The only way to know when a particular item is going to be restocked is to e-mail or call the company themselves to ask. Answers you may get on CD won't be as accurate as those the company can give you.

Re: Plans to Restock Items?

FYI, as a completely random aside and since I happen to work in the marine shipping industry, I thought I would give everyone some fun facts!

The global container shipping industry is experiencing an unprecedented event with the largest bankruptcy of a shipping company in history.

Hanjin Shipping, the world's seventh largest containership company operating over 100 ships has filed for bankruptcy. (Over 7% of the total container capacity from Asia to North America)

Dozens of ships have been denied port access and are anchored or drifting with containers onboard because the ports/stevedores do not trust that they will be paid.

Hopefully the ripple effects throughout the container industry, will not have a major impact on the upcoming season. . .
This the the 4th container company (in the top 15 largest 9 months ago) to be out of business or going out of business.
